Figure 1 Lassa virus geographical distribution and virus structure.

Notes: Lassa virus has caused numerous outbreaks and is endemic to Nigeria, Guinea, Sierra Leone, and Liberia (red). There is also strong evidence of Lassa virus infections (beige) throughout much of West Africa (WHO Lassa Report, 2018Citation66). The Lassa virus structure and genome are also depicted.

Figure 2 Disease course of Lassa virus infection and efficacy of various preventative strategies.

Notes: The timeline of various aspects of disease course during Lassa virus infection in the most commonly used animal models and in humans (A), and the timeline of administration of various preventative strategies against Lassa virus infection (B). Each of the vaccine strategies listed has shown protective efficacy in guinea pigs and/or NHPs when administered at the day listed relative to infection. *Following symptom onset.
